It is used to speed up throttle response or slow it down... The drive by wire throttle is much slower in opening the throttle as a means of improving fuel mileage. Having an adjustable throttle controller allows you to choose how quickly or slowly the throttle responds to your right foot... It really helps acceleration in the sport settings and the slower economy settings with slower response to your right foot is helpful in improving fuel mileage..

Sir,
No Panic. Just sent you the walkthrough now. Pls follow the walkthrough step by step.
We had 1 similar report as yours and turned out that installer only connect 1 head of the harness to stock connector but forget to insert the other head into the signal box above pedal.
Also, pls check and see if all wires coming out of control box and harness are firm. This might also be one of the causes.
Remember, never drive w/ TC on if you haven't done correct programming steps.

User modes I played with on day 1.
EC7 - Driving Miss Daisy mode - Serious gas saver. I stalled while taking off on a hill. There is a lot of hesitation in the pedal. Be careful she'll be a putter. Takes some time to get use to.
EC5 - I found this to be really good on the street. Slows ya down some but easy to get use too.
Norm - This feels fast after you are in any EC mode. Crazy how you feel the difference when switched while driving.
SP5 - Fun. Really moves. Get rid of that hesitation in the pedal. You can really feel a difference in the performance.
SP9 - "KITT, turbo boost NOW"!!!! Be careful on this one. Its way to much fun. No kidding the second you get on the pedal my FIT would spin the tires out of first every time. I can see johnny law & me meeting on this mode.
I have to say is the best bang for the buck part I have ever gotten.
